Greater Manchester Combined Authority
Delivery of works to repair existing and create new External Yard and Training Areas at GMFRS Training and Safety Centre Bury
The procurement contact named on the official notice.
The Contract Works are to refurbish the Sage Building at Bury Training Centre including the construction of a new Kitchen and Dining facility, Incident Command Training Centre, Classrooms and Office Facility.
This work involves the stripping out of some existing facilities, replacement roof, dining room extension, remodelling, finishes and full replacement of all building services systems.
The work is being funded by the GMCA from its own resources and budget approval has been received.
The Contract Duration of the Works on site is expected to be 12 weeks, the Form of Contract will be the JCT Intermediate Form with Contractors Design 2016 Edition.
The Contractors Design elements are the steel-to-steel connections and the piling to the drill tower bases.
